The invention relates to the technical field of pervious concrete bricks, in particular to a cement-free pervious concrete brick which comprises a bottom plate and a frame vertically arranged along the periphery of the bottom plate, an annular supporting cylinder vertically extending upwards is arranged on the bottom plate in the frame, and a panel for blocking an opening in the upper end of the annular supporting cylinder is fixedly arranged at the upper end of the annular supporting cylinder; rainwater and surface runoff can be collected in the pervious concrete block lower than the overflowgroove through the panel, the pervious concrete and the annular supporting cylinder, the phenomenon of road surface water accumulation is avoided, the pressure of urban drainage equipment is reduced,and the risk of urban inland inundation is reduced; meanwhile, in hot days after raining, the stored water can be evaporated, the pavement temperature is reduced, pavement sensible heat emission is reduced, and the urban heat island effect is reduced.
